    Implement and maintain vDefend distributed firewall rules and basic micro-segmentation policies within established design patterns.

    Configure and maintain NSX security groups, tags, and policy objects for standard workloads.

    Support Identity Broker configuration, federation trust setup, and basic role/access mappings.

    Perform routine security hardening tasks for VCF components including vSphere, NSX, and SDDC Manager.

    Assist with security configuration reviews, vulnerability remediation, and evidence collection for compliance checks.

    Translate approved cybersecurity requirements into repeatable platform control changes with guidance from senior engineers.

    Document security configurations, standard operating procedures, and implementation runbooks.

    Participate in incident response and operational support for platform security issues.

    Preferred Qualifications

    Exposure to VMware NSX, vDefend, or virtual networking/security concepts.

    Exposure to zero trust, segmentation, or policy-based security models.

    Familiarity with Azure security fundamentals or cloud IAM concepts.

    Security+, VMware certification, or equivalent foundational certification.

    Exposure to scripting or automation using PowerShell, PowerCLI, or Python.

    Required Qualifications

    Bachelor's degree in Information Technology, Cybersecurity, Computer Science, or related field; or equivalent practical experience.

    Minimum 1 year of experience in infrastructure, systems, networking, or security engineering.

    Foundational knowledge of infrastructure security concepts, firewalls, IAM, and virtualization.

    Hands-on experience with VMware vSphere administration or support.

    Familiarity with basic security frameworks such as CIS or NIST.

    Experience working with change management and technical documentation.
